Dominari Holdings names Brian Parsley to board of directors
Dominari Holdings Inc. (NASDAQ: DOMH) appointed Brian Parsley to its board of directors, the company announced September 10. Parsley will focus on enhancing the firm's marketing, investor outreach and communications strategy.
Parsley brings over 30 years of experience in entrepreneurship, sales and leadership development. He founded and exited multiple companies, including USAhire.com and WeSkill, both of which were acquired. He currently co-founded The Constance Group, where he works with organizations on sales and leadership culture transformation through behavioral science.
"Brian has a proven ability to transform sales and leadership cultures, with a focus on linking human behavior to measurable business outcomes," said Anthony Hayes, chief executive officer of Dominari Holdings. "His expertise in human connection, communication and business growth will be invaluable as we execute our growth strategy."
Parsley developed a framework called The Human Factor, which he uses to advise executives and teams on performance enhancement and business outcomes through authentic human connection. He has consulted with Fortune 500 companies and was recognized as a Top 40 Executive Under 40 by the Business Journal.
"In today's market, success depends not only on financial performance but also on how well a company communicates its story and its long-term vision," Parsley said. "My focus will be on helping Dominari strengthen its voice in the marketplace, deepen engagement with investors and foster authentic connections that drive both trust and growth."
Dominari Securities LLC, a subsidiary of Dominari Holdings, provides securities brokerage and registered investment adviser services. The company is a member of FINRA, MSRB and SIPC.
